基于微信小程序的开发是一个涉及多个步骤和技术的过程。以下是一个详细的开发指南,帮助您从零开始构建微信小程序:
一、注册小程序账号
1. 访问微信公众平台:首先,需要在微信公众平台([https://mp.weixin.qq.com/](https://mp.weixin.qq.com/))注册一个小程序账号。
2. 填写注册信息:按照要求填写相关信息,包括邮箱、密码、验证码等,并进行真实性验证。
3. 完成邮箱验证:登录注册时填写的邮箱,完成邮箱验证。
4. 选择小程序类型:在注册过程中,选择“小程序”作为账号类型。
5. 完善小程序信息:填写小程序名称、头像、简介等信息,并设置服务类目。
二、准备开发工具
1. 下载并安装微信开发者工具:访问微信公众平台,进入小程序管理页面,找到开发者工具的下载地址,根据操作系统选择对应的版本进行下载安装。微信开发者工具是官方提供的集成开发环境,用于编写、调试和发布小程序。
2. 选择或搭建开发框架:可以选择使用小程序自带的演示程序或者从现有的小程序源码中构建框架,也可以选择使用第三方小程序制作工具来快速搭建框架。
三、开发小程序页面
1. 设计界面:根据需求设计小程序的界面,包括选择主题色调、设计图标、布局页面等。在设计过程中,要注重用户体验,确保界面简洁明了。
2. 编写代码:
逻辑层(JS):编写原生的JavaScript代码或使用微信提供的API来实现数据处理、业务逻辑和与视图层的交互。
视图层(WXML):使用WXML(微信小程序的一种标签化语言,类似于HTML)来构建页面的布局。
样式层(WXSS):使用WXSS(微信小程序的一种样式语言,类似于CSS)来设计页面的样式。
四、调试与预览
1. 使用微信开发者工具进行调试:在开发过程中,可以使用微信开发者工具进行实时的代码调试和性能优化。
2. 预览效果:在微信开发者工具中点击“预览”按钮,扫描生成的二维码即可在手机上查看小程序的效果。
五、申请发布与审核
1. 提交审核:当小程序开发完成后,需要在微信公众平台提交审核。在提交审核前,需要确保小程序符合微信平台的相关规范和要求。
2. 等待审核结果:提交审核后,需要等待微信团队的审核结果。审核通过后,小程序即可正式上线。
六、持续优化与迭代
1. 关注用户反馈:小程序上线后,需要关注用户的反馈和意见,及时进行优化和改进。
2. 数据分析:利用微信平台提供的数据分析工具来分析用户行为和数据指标,为优化提供数据支持。
3. 迭代更新:根据用户需求和市场变化,不断迭代更新小程序的功能和界面。
七、注意事项
1. 遵守规范:在开发过程中,要严格遵守微信平台的相关规范和要求,确保小程序的质量和稳定性。
2. 保护用户隐私:在收集和使用用户信息时,要遵循相关法律法规和微信平台的规定,确保用户隐私的安全。
3. 性能优化:关注小程序的性能表现,进行必要的性能优化以提升用户体验。
通过以上步骤和注意事项,您可以成功开发并发布一个微信小程序。不过请注意,由于技术和平台的不断发展变化,具体的开发流程和工具可能会有所更新和调整,建议及时关注微信官方的最新信息和动态。